如果您需要高效地去重,并且您提到的日期和时间是唯一的标识符,以下是一些通用的去重方法:
1. 使用数据库:
如果数据存储在数据库中,可以使用SQL查询中的`DISTINCT`关键字或者使用数据库的聚合函数来去重。
2. 编程语言:
使用Python、Java、C等编程语言,可以使用集合(Set)或字典(Dictionary)等数据结构来去除重复项。
例如,Python中可以使用以下代码去重:
```python
unique_items = list(set(your_list))
```
或者使用`pandas`库:
```python
import pandas as pd
df = pd.DataFrame(your_data)
df_unique = df.drop_duplicates()
```
3. 文本处理:
如果是文本数据,可以使用正则表达式或者字符串操作函数来去除重复的字符串。
4. 手动去重:
对于小规模数据,可以手动检查和删除重复项。
5. 工具软件:
使用专业的数据清理软件,如Excel的高级筛选功能或者专门的去重工具。
具体到您提到的日期和时间“真2024年3月8日19时40分44秒”,以下是一个简单的Python示例,展示如何去重:
```python
from datetime import datetime
假设有一个包含日期时间的列表
date_times = [
"2024年3月8日19时40分44秒",
"2024年3月8日19时40分44秒",
"2024年3月9日20时00分00秒",
"2024年3月8日19时40分44秒"
]
将字符串转换为datetime对象,然后去重
unique_date_times = list(set(datetime.strptime(dt, "%Y年%m月%d日%H时%M分%S秒") for dt in date_times))
将datetime对象转换回字符串
unique_date_times_str = [dt.strftime("%Y年%m月%d日%H时%M分%S秒") for dt in unique_date_times]
print(unique_date_times_str)
```
这段代码首先将日期时间字符串转换为`datetime`对象,然后使用集合去重,最后再将去重后的`datetime`对象转换回字符串。这样可以确保日期时间的唯一性。